Output 66d042356fa0f4298811dfcc24ffbac042f48f68ff12f0af9d4afdc22ea4a585:0

value
998304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090297d89ca2c189366a8ba21e8463c1cef599fd OP_EQUAL
address
32Wf7SnWCJxSLUJVf1T7Cw5kteC8nw1MUY
transaction
66d042356fa0f4298811dfcc24ffbac042f48f68ff12f0af9d4afdc22ea4a585
spent
true